Synopsis of ascent of mount carmel in order to reach the union of light, the soul must pass through the dark night that is to say, through a series of purifications, during which it is walking, as it were, through a tunnel of impenetrable obscurity and from which it emerges to bask in the sunshine of grace and to enjoy the divine intimacy. All the doctrine whereof i intend to treat in this ascent of mount carmel is included in the following stanzas, and in them is also described the manner of ascending to the summit of the mount, which is the high estate of perfection which we here call union of the soul with god. Ascent of mount carmel catholic spiritual direction. Describes two different nights through which spiritual persons pass, according to the two parts of man, the lower and the higher. Written between 1578 and 1579 in granada, spain, after johns escape from prison, the ascent is illustrated by a diagram of the process outlined in the text of the souls progress to the summit of the metaphorical mount carmel where god is encountered.
